Parties have fielded candidates for the upcoming by-election for the Torry/Ferryhill ward following the resignation of the SNP's Cllr. Catriona Mackenzie.

The seven candidates who have been put forward for the vote on November 21st are:
Audrey Nicoll - Scottish National Party
Willie Young - Labour
Neil Murray - Scottish Conservative and Unionist
Simon Paul McLean - Independent
Gregor McAbery - Liberal Democrats
Betty Lion - Green Party
Roy Hill - UKIP
Still currently serving the ward is Yvonne Allan (Labour), Christian Allard (SNP) and Alan Donnelly (Conservatives).
Whether or not the SNP can retain their seat here is unclear, with several weeks of campaigning ahead for prospective candidates to have their cases heard.
